There are many facilities in the New York area that are warehouses filled with inflatables and trampolines known as a bounce house. These bounce houses can be fun for children’s parties and events but they can also be quite hazardous if they are not designed properly. Another problem with these bounce houses is that they are often under staffed and may not have enough employees working to sufficiently supervise the occupants of the facility. There are many causes of bounce house and trampoline accidents and some of the most common causes are:
  • The facility is over capacity for the number of occupants allowed
  • There are too many people using one feature at the same time
  • Small children and older children are not separated and allowed to use the same equipment at the same time
  • Children using the equipment are over the maximum or under the minimum weight restrictions
  • The facility is not prepared to handle an accident or takes little precautions to avoid injury

Common injuries sustained in bounce houses or on trampolines can include:

  • Broken or fractured bones
  • Deep cuts or lacerations
  • Severe head injury including traumatic brain injury
  • Neck and back injuries
  • Spinal cord injuries and more

Children can also be injured on trampolines at private residences. Children should be supervised when using these trampolines and they need to be regularly inspected for safety. In order to successfully file a claim against an establishment or against a private party you must prove that negligence contributed to the accident and injuries.
